Mwalim

Awakened by a Noon Day Sun

2016-12-05

Mwalim aka DaPhunkee Professor brings his compilation of jazz-funk compositions, with instrumental music that sounds like it is infused with nature. You can hear a multitude of his various influences throughout his songs, melding together a sound that is pretty unique.

My personal favorite is the first track on the album, Wade in the Water.

review by Jaymie
